| windows 7 home premium 64 bit | blueray player problems hi iam hoping some body can help ive put a blue ray player in my machine it will play audio cd's but will not play dvd's or blueray discs. So before i reload windows has any body got any ideas thank you Last edited by barman58; 12-22-2008 at 06:34 PM.. |

| Vista Ultimate X64 SP2 | Re: blueray player problems Did you install dvd/blu-ray playback software? Only Ultimate has the out of the box dvd video codecs (but not HD codecs for blu-ray). | Vista Ultimate X64 SP2 | Re: blueray player problems Check default programs and make sure powerdvd is default for both dvd/blu-ray. If you cannot open the following programs you may need to reinstall Cyberlink software suite. LG GGC-H20L Super Multi Blue Blu-ray Disc & HD DVD-ROM - Software Bundle CyberLink PowerDVD 7 Ultra The version of PowerDVD bundled with the GGC-H20L only supports 2 speaker output. If you want to take advantage of movies encoded with Dolby Digital or DTS, you'll need to buy the retail version of PowerDVD Ultra. | Vista Ultimate X64 SP2 | Re: blueray player problems This will tell you if there are any problem issues with your computer That could be preventing playback- including the drive itself. If you are all in the "Green", consider upgrading your software. Cyberlink BD Advisor Note- Make sure you are running Vista SP1 as otherwise Vista will probably see your BD Drive as a DVD Drive. And you might want to think about upgrading your PowerDVD Ultra to a retail/download version. I have heard many people say they had problems with Blu-ray playback using the OEM version- and patches are far and inbetween. Last edited by rive0108; 12-08-2008 at 07:46 PM.. |
